IQNA – Ceremonies continue to be held in different countries in commemoration of Iranian President Ebrahim Raisi and his companions who were killed in a recent helicopter crash.

A memorial service was organized at the holy shrine of Hazat Zeynab (SA) in the suburbs of Syria’s capital of Damascus for Iranian President Ebrahim Raisi and his companions who were killed in a recent helicopter crash.

 

A memorial service was organized at the holy shrine of Hazrat Zeynab (SA) in the suburbs of Syria’s capital of Damascus, attended by political and military figures from Syria as well as representatives from resistance movement groups in Lebanon, Iraq and Palestine. 

The speakers expressed condolences to and voiced solidarity with the Iranian nation and leadership over the tragic losses.

Hezbollah representative Sheikh Akram Dayyab highlighted the Iranian president and foreign minister’s support for the axis of resistance and said Iran will continue supporting resistance in the region after their martyrdom.

Abu Mujahid, an official with the Islamic Jihad movement also addressed the event, praising the Iranian martyrs’ efforts to defend the Palestinian nation.

In New York, a commemoration program was held at the Al-Khoei Islamic Center on Thursday evening.

It was attended by Iran’s permanent envoy to the United Nations and other diplomats as well as religious figures and others from different countries.

The United Nations is also planning to organize a memorial service for President Raisi and Foreign Minister Hossein Amir-Abdollahian.

UN General Assembly President Dennis Francis announced this in a statement published by the UN website.

He said the memorial will be held at the UN General Assembly at 10 AM local time on May 30.

A helicopter carrying President Raisi, Foreign Minister Amir-Abdollahian, Friday prayers leader of Tabriz Ayatollah Mohammad Ali Al-e-Hashem, Governor of East Azarbaijan Malek Rahmati, the commander of the president’s security team, two pilots and a flight crew crashed in the northwestern province of East Azarbaijan on May 19, 2024. Their bodies were found on Monday after an extensive night-long search operation.

Iran observed five days of national mourning this week with funeral processions for the victims held in multiple cities.

President Raisi was laid to rest at Imam Reza (AS) shrine in Mashhad and Amir-Abdollahian was buried at the holy mausoleum of Hazrat Abdul Azim Hassani (AS) in Rey, south of Tehran, marking the end of days of funeral processions attended by millions of Iranians in several cities.
